Output d40aacbf234f1ee2fe22dd63f7b9a7b23f1485f7ae28a753ee0c37b28fd34399:3

value
4343947
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e518c68f65b572c3985794c1bb69caa2a8570a4 OP_EQUAL
address
3G88NwVvDZnL4srukT3RdvrytqSRWseren
transaction
d40aacbf234f1ee2fe22dd63f7b9a7b23f1485f7ae28a753ee0c37b28fd34399
spent
true